Love Island series 12 champion Toni Laites has publicly expressed her honest opinion following the dramatic return of Harrison Solomon to the franchise as a bombshell on the All Stars edition. This development comes just seven months after their original series concluded, reigniting interest among fans and viewers.

Background of the Love Triangle and Past Drama

During the previous season, audiences witnessed Toni becoming entangled in a complex love triangle involving Harrison Solomon and his now-former girlfriend, Lauren Wood. Ultimately, Toni recoupled with Cach Mercer, and the pair went on to win the competition, while Harrison chose to leave the villa to pursue Lauren after she was eliminated from the show.

Now, as Harrison engages with other contestants in the South African villa for All Stars, Toni has made her feelings abundantly clear through a pointed social media post.

Toni's Social Media Swipe and Fan Reactions

On a TikTok video captioned, "I've held my pettiness back for too long ?", Toni lip-synced to an audio stating: "That's not what the fans wanna see, that's literally what the fans don't wanna see." She reinforced her stance by overlaying the video with the text, "That's enough all stars for me this szn", indicating her disapproval of Harrison's participation.

The video quickly went viral, resonating strongly with Love Island enthusiasts. One fan commented: "Haha you're so real ?? I feel the same way too Toni." Another supporter wrote: "Honestly facts! Get OUTTTTT????." These responses highlight the divided opinions among the show's fanbase regarding Harrison's return.

Contrasting Opinions from Close Friends

While Toni expressed dissatisfaction with Harrison's All Stars appearance, her close friend Harry Cooksley showcased excitement over the development. In a recent TikTok video reviewing All Stars episodes, Harry was ecstatic, exclaiming: "The bull is back in town! This is exactly what we're here for - and yes, I've been keeping it a secret for the last three weeks."

Harry added: "He is one of my best pals, I will say that. So I will support him, but I will also critique him." This contrast underscores the varied perspectives within the Love Island community, with some celebrating Harrison's comeback and others, like Toni, questioning its merit.
